Bear Claw Lodge
The Cliffs at Kispiox River is home to the 15,000 square foot post-and-beam Bearclaw Lodge located on the world-famous Kispiox River (Containing the world's largest strain of wild Steelhead). Imposing 22’ carved Totem Poles stand guard in the foyer behind the massive, three story river rock fireplace. Snowcapped Baldy Mountain dominates the view from the dining room windows, where our heliskiiers are only an 8 minute flight from. Bedroom sliding glass doors open to a stone walk balcony overlooking the Kispiox River. The scent of cedar and fresh homemade bread drifts through the lodge. At the Cliffs at Kispiox River, we offer an elite familiar environment. With only 8 guest bedrooms, our guests can enjoy exclusive luxury in a private setting. Each room is designed with a different local and unique theme. Handcrafted beds and furniture fill the rooms with the smell of fresh cedar.
We have a games room featuring a Kispiox river rock jacuzzi, foos ball table, pool table, satellite T.V., cards table and comfortable furniture. The lodge has free wireless internet and a satellite phone ($3.99/minute).
The lodge is filled with unique local art, including several pieces from world renowned Gitksan artist, Roy Vickers. Most of the artwork throughout the lodge is on consignment by the artist.
